There’s a common myth that the World Cup format remains stagnant through the years. However, the FIFA World Cup has evolved significantly, particularly heading into the 2026 tournament. This edition is set to be the largest in history, with 48 teams competing, up from 32. The tournament will feature a total of 104 matches, a significant increase from the 64 matches played in previous editions. Did You Know?
The 2026 World Cup will feature matches in three countries: the United States, Canada, and Mexico, marking the first time the tournament will be hosted by three nations.
